Instead of giving a full review of this story I’ll share my personal thoughts and how I felt. Indigo by Beverly Jenkins is my first historical romance novel that I read. I always wanted to read historical romances but had no idea where to start. I knew for a fact that I wanted to read some written by a black author to start me off. Indigo sets the tone of what real romance is especially during a dangerous time like the 1800s where blacks were bought and sold into slavery and had very little power.

I strongly believe Beverly Jenkins captured the historical part very well and made it seem very believable. 
Hester and Galen are the perfect couple. Hester I felt was a strong woman and did for herself she wasn’t use to a man doing for her. Which for me I’m glad the author didn’t write Hester as a weak woman that needed a man for everything. And Galen he is a alpha male he knows what he wants and goes after it. He knew he wanted Hester and wouldn’t stop until he had Hester as his wife.

The whole story is swoon worthy. Every page when Hester and Galen were together I was smiling and I felt happy for them. They have gone through so much together and in the end still managed to be together and build their family, even during the tough times that was slavery.

Concisely arresting and challenging the beliefs of family and the fantasies of tradition, the poems in Surviving Home show that home is a place that you endure rather than a place where you are nurtured. With unyielding cadence and unparalleled sadness and warmth, Katerina Canyon contemplates the prejudice and limitations buried in a person’s African American heritage: parents that seem to care for you with one hand and slap you with the other, the secret desires to be released from the daily burdens of life, as well as the surprising ways a child chooses to amuse herself. Finding resilience in the unexpected, this collection tears down the delicate facades of family.
